Dynamisch auf Steuerelemente zugreifen

  • Antworten:2
  • Bentwortet
Nightfly
  • Forum-Beiträge: 25

06.01.2011, 22:56:45 via Website

Ich habe mehrere Images, die Image1, Image2, Image3 usw heißen.
Besteht die Möglichkeit diese Imageviews dynamisch in einer schleife anzusprechen?

am besten wäre so:

int count = 1;
while ( count <= 9 ) {
Image(und jetzt halt die count Variable).setImageResource(R.drawable.bild);

}


ich könnte es so lösen, aber das wäre ja nervig:

int count = 1;
while ( count <= 9 ) {
if (count == 1)
{
Image1.setImageResource(R.drawable.bild);
}
if (count == 2)
{
Image2.setImageResource(R.drawable.bild);
}
if (count == 3)
{
Image3.setImageResource(R.drawable.bild);
}
}

— geändert am 06.01.2011, 22:57:46

Antworten
Markus Gu
  • Forum-Beiträge: 2.644

06.01.2011, 23:04:34 via App

mach ein array deiner images

swordiApps Blog - Website

Antworten
Nightfly
  • Forum-Beiträge: 25

12.01.2011, 09:42:24 via Website

Funktioniert, danke!

Antworten